A proper drain field needs to have perforated pipes buried in gravel trenches through out the field. The trenches should have a slight slope, usually less than 1/8th inch per foot. …

Crushed stone grade no. 67 is another special grade containing rocks that are less than 1” with an average size of ¾ inch. It is screened to exclude stone dust and pea gravel so that it will not compact and remains workable by hand, making it an ideal construction ...
